services

Individual therapy /counselling is a process in which clients meet on a one-on-one basis with a registered psychologist in a safe, caring and confidential environment to work through situations which are challenging to them in some way

Couples therapy involves a process whereby a couple meets with a therapist to work on specific identified areas of difficulty in their relationship. A couple can be married, engaged, dating, divorced or pre-divorce.

Group therapy is a process where a group of people (usually with similar interests or difficulties) meet on a regular basis in a confidential setting with a trained therapist to work on specific issues e.g. grief, divorce adjustment, depression, anger management

About  Me

Hello, I'm Cheryl Sol, a Registered Clinical Psychologist, working in private practice in Kloof, KZN, South Africa. I have practiced as a Clinical Psychologist/Therapist for over 25 years, working with individuals, couples and groups. 

While I run a private practice, my career journey has also included lecturing and supervising undergraduate and post graduate psychology students, training lay counsellors at NGO’s, writing articles of psychological interest for magazines, and working as a consultant for an international war tribunal.
